2. Ask you partner the quiz question, then count the Yes answers and summarize your partner’s image. How Ambitious Are You?

  1. Do you always take games and competitions seriously?

  2. Do you work hard at things that are important for your future?

  3. Do you do things better when someone is watching you?

  4. Do you feel happy when someone praises you for doing something well?

  5. If you had organized a trip or a party for your friends very carefully, would you get angry if something went wrong?

  6. In a swimming race with a friend who is younger than you, you know that you could easily win. Do you swim your fastest?

  7. If you do worse than a friend in a school test, do you tear up your test paper angrily?

  8. If a friend couldn’t do his or her homework, would you help willingly?

  9. Do you try to do everything as correctly as you can?

  10. If you were ill before an exam and had hardly done any work for it, would you try to avoid taking the exam?

If you have…

1 to 3 You are not very ambitious. People like you because of this, but you shouldn’t take things too lightly. Life is something competitive.

4 to 6You are ambitious and competitive, but your ambition does not rule your life.

7 to 10You are too ambitious. Don’t take all your activities so seriously. Try to relax and have some fun.

I. Find the mistakes and correct them. If there are no mistakes, put a .

  1. She speaks French fluent.

  2. I think you behaved very cowardilly.

  3. Everyone says that he's now enormous rich.

  4. We'll never catch them up if you walk as slow as that.

  5. She turned to him astonishedly. 'I don't believe you," she said.

  6. Wearing a white shirt and new suit, he thought he looked really well.

  7. We produced five million of tractors last year.

  8. Chop the herbs finely and sprinkle them on top of the pasta.

  9. He stepped back and looked satisfiedly at the newly-painted door.

  10. He is the nineth child in the family.
